Snow Jk llrown, Ihe enter-prilns proprietors of the (treat Southern Music lloti-e. at 'Mobile, havcjiiit oiened a esl.ib-lishmn.l -it Xs. lo- nnd lot 1) niphiii street. Il is decidedly the mol attractive and elegant stoic in the cily. A front of fifty feet, all French plate glass, allords a splendid opportunity for display.

And it is ipiito a treat to ee the elegant ebraiinos, engr iv-ngs. slen ospiir goods, fancy articles, lichly embroidered piano covers and musical instruments of every description, that are on exhibition. Nidi an array of uijos, ifuitars, accoi ili-ons, I drums, brass instruments; such a large and splendid stock of the most costly music boxes, violins, church and parlor organs, we never saw be-fore in Mobile. Their stock of sheet music is immense, being constantly replenished from the publishing houses at the Xorth, and COHllirisill all that is dcsiiable in the i.v ol lor- I eign music and home prodtietiotis. In addition to (ho world renowned ('bickering pianos, for which Messrs.

Snow Iiiowi! are State agents, they have rereiilly added lo their stock the magnificent, cycloids of Lindctuan Sous.tlu (ieo. Slick and Slan-lev Sous' pianos, and a new and beautiful variety of Peloubet Pctton and isou ll imlins' well known cabinet organs, all of which arc sold at manufacturers prices. Another attractive feature about this establishment is the very low prices at which the various articles are offered. Messrs. Snew Browu ap preciate the times and sell accordingly.

When you go to Mobile don't lajj lo see their store and examine their stock. lu connection with the store they have a very find work-shop, lilted up with tools and requirements of a piano factors, and they arc doing a great deal of repairing of instruments of nil kinds. This itself is a new feature in Mobile, one we arc lad to see. The most costly In- struiueuls ran be thoroughly overhauled and put in perlect order for about what the cost of transportation would be to send them Xorth. The Mobilians are justly proud of every tiling which lends a new charm or attraction to their city, and the throngs nf l-tde that tit" (treat Southern Music House is sufficient evidence of the appreciation of the effort of Messrs, Snow Urowu lo render the.ircstablishmcut the Imcst in the South.
